The Inspack is responsible for inspecting each bag produced to identify defects such as improper seals, perforations, or deformities. Performs counting, sorting and packing bags according to customer specifications, ensuring compliance with quality standards. Reports production or machine issues and maintains a clean and organized work area.
Responsibilities- Visually inspect each bag for defects such as improper seals, perforations, or deformities.
- Sort and separate defective products from the approved batch.
- Accurately count and pack bags according to customer or production specifications.
- Label packages and ensure they are ready for storage or shipment.
- Report any material or machine issue to the supervisor.
- Assist in general production line tasks when necessary.
- Maintain a clean and organized work area, following safety and hygiene standards.
